Cherry Tea Cakes

1 C Powdered Sugar
1 C Butter
1 T Cherry liquid (from the maraschino cherries)
1/2 t Almond extract
3-4 Drops red Food coloring
2 1/4 C Flour
1/2 t Salt
1/2 C Chopped drained maraschino cherries
1/2 C White chocolate chips, optional

  • Beat sugar and butter together until light and fluffy. Add cherry liquid, almond extract, and food coloring and beat to incorporate. Beat in flour and salt. Stir in cherries (and white chocolate chips if you decide to include them).
  • Shape into 1 inch balls, pat down with fingers to flatten slightly. Bake 8-10 minutes. (They are good soft, but even better when crisp like traditional shortbread, but watch them so the bottoms don’t burn.) Cool 20 minutes.
  • Melt chocolate and drizzle over the cookies (optional).
